NEW DELHI: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Sunday expressed his delight at the increased participation of India’s youth in events like Ironman 70.3, which was held in Goa and congratulated the participants in the race.
“Glad to see increased participation by our youth in events like Ironman 70.3, which was held in Goa today. Such events contribute towards #FitIndia movement,” PM Modi said in a post on X.
“Congratulations to everyone who took part. Delighted that two of our young Party colleagues, Annamalai and Tejasvi Surya, are among those who have successfully completed the Ironman Triathlon,” he added.
The fifth edition of IRONMAN 70.3 Goa began spectacularly earlier in the day, as Goa Chief Minister Pramod Sawant flagged off the race from the iconic Miramar Beach.
